Are you having trouble finding the right sling.  Can’t figure out whether to go with a single point, two point or three-point.  From my 8 years in the military and deployments under my belt I have dealt with all three.  From my experience I have found that the one point sling is the best you can go with.  It’s just way to easy to maneuver from strong side to weak side.  The mobility of a single point sling is what makes it stand out from the obscene amount of slings out there.

On this blog I will be talking about one sling.  The Condor Cobra one point.  This thing is just straight KICK A$$.   The durability of this sling is on point.  I have had it on my military M4 for about three weeks now putting it through all sorts of rigorous training and its keeping up.  It features a 1.25″ webbing with Duraflex buckles. Also, a snap hook adapter covered with elastic and a side-release buckle to release adapter and sling.  The elastic inside is dual banded and is also very durable.  Trust me, I tried breaking it and couldn’t.  It also comes in 4 different colors(Multicam, Black, OD, and Tan).  This is the sling I am taking to Afghanistan with me.  I guarantee that it will last the 1 year tour that i have coming up.

The pros and cons for this sling are definitely one-sided.  The pros are that it is very durable.  It comes in 4 different colors.  Bungee is a dual core.  The Duraflex buckles are really strong and do not disconnect when hard tension is applied.  The release adapter is key when either getting in and out of vehicles or fixed fighting positions. Also this is made in the great US of A.  There are also a lot of companies out there that make numerous variations of sling mounts for your weapon.  Now for the cons or should I say con.  The only thing that I do not like about this sling is that if you walk a lot it and have wide shoulders like I do.  It starts to rub on your neck a little bit.  But if you are wearing some sort of body armor like IBA, IOTV or just a regular plate carrier.  Then you should have no problem with this.

  • Single point sling
  • Dual bungee construction
  • HK snap hook adapter covered with elastic
  • Side-release buckle to release adapter and sling
  • 1 1/4 inch webbing covered in Multicam fabric, Duraflex buckles.(only for the multicam version)
